## Enforce same-day order cutoff for Crumbelle Bakery

This change adds a hard cutoff for same-day orders. Orders placed after the cutoff now roll to the next open business day automatically, and customers see the adjusted fulfillment date at checkout. Support should expect fewer "where is my order" tickets for late-evening purchases. The cutoff time, grace window, and rollover rules are driven by the constants below.

tuning constants:
QUOTAS = {
    "druwyn": 5,
    "holix": 5,
    "zorath": 5,
    "holwyn": 10,
}

Handover — Crumbline order-cutoff rule. For the new contractor: cutoff is 14:00 local per bakery, enforced in the Ovenly scheduler, not the storefront. Marza moved the config to the rules service last sprint; the old YAML is dead, ignore it. Tests live in cutoff_spec. If the rules service admin console locks you out, use the emergency recovery flow. The recovery passphrase you'll need is directly below.

strongbox words: sorir-belvan-rusix-ulays-ralmir-praix-eliir-tamax-praael-druael-julir-tamius-jorir

**Alert: Gridsmith puzzle queue backing up**

Heads up, support folks — this alert fires when the Gridsmith crossword generator's render queue sits above 200 pending puzzles for more than ten minutes. Users will see "still baking your puzzle" spinners longer than usual, and a few may write in about timeouts. Usually it's a stuck solver worker; restarting the pool clears it in a couple of minutes. Triage steps and the restart procedure are on the internal page below.

operations page: https://jenkins.zemvarcloud.local/job/merge_requests/repo/build/73930b4b30f0a8ed

Reseller Programme — Ferngate Instruments (Managers Only)

This page covers eligibility criteria, tier thresholds, and co-marketing obligations for the Ferngate reseller network. Sales leads must verify partner certification before quoting tier-two pricing, and document all exceptions carefully. Changes to tier structure take effect next quarter, as explained in the confidential note below.

management briefing: Project Ulavan slips by two quarters because of the staffing delay.